#7
I found the website cumbersome so I just ended up calling. My request was a little different - I asked for a custom mix - and wanted new/pristine tail lights to start with. He picked up new tails from a local California MB dealer and sprayed just the reverse portion of the tail lights. IIRC, the cost was near $500, including the new 4-piece tail lights...but they have a factory look which is what I wanted. Years later they are still perfect.
